Mike Espy, a Mississippi Democrat whose heated special Senate runoff against Cindy Hyde-Smith in 2018 turned into a nationally watched affair, announced on Tuesday that he will challenge her to a rematch in 2020

Espy, a former US member of the House and agriculture secretary in the Clinton administration, would be the state's first black senator since Reconstruction if elected. Last year, he fell short in his race against Hyde-Smith, losing by 8 percentage points despite her having a string of controversies, many of them touching on issues of race."It's official.
